SUNDOG: A TRON-Based Canine

SUNDOG, as the name suggests, is a memecoin built on the TRON blockchain. Inspired by the success of Dogecoin and Shiba Inu, SUNDOG aims to provide a fun and engaging experience for users. With its playful theme and the advantages of the TRON network, including fast transaction speeds and low fees, SUNDOG has garnered significant attention.

One of the key factors driving SUNDOG's popularity is the active support from Justin Sun, the founder of TRON. Sun has been instrumental in promoting memecoins on his blockchain, contributing to increased demand and activity. This has resulted in TRON's recent surge in popularity, entering the top 10 of the crypto charts.

NEIRO: The Ethereum-Based Sister of DOGE

NEIRO, another promising memecoin, is built on the Ethereum blockchain as an ERC-20 token. Positioned as the "sister of DOGE," NEIRO aims to create a fun and engaged community within the cryptocurrency space. While the comparison to Dogecoin might be somewhat inaccurate, given Dogecoin's own blockchain, NEIRO's association with a popular memecoin has undoubtedly contributed to its initial success.

Despite its recent launch, NEIRO has experienced a significant price surge, indicating strong interest from investors. However, it's important to note that memecoins are highly volatile assets, and their prices can fluctuate rapidly.

The Rise of Memecoins

The growing popularity of memecoins can be attributed to several factors. First, their playful and often humorous themes resonate with a wide audience, making them accessible to both experienced crypto investors and newcomers. Second, the community-driven nature of memecoins fosters a sense of belonging and camaraderie among holders. Finally, the potential for rapid price appreciation, although risky, has attracted many speculators.

Q: What are memecoins?

A: Memecoins are cryptocurrencies inspired by internet memes or cultural phenomena. They often have playful themes and are driven by community engagement.

Q: What are the advantages of investing in memecoins?

A: Potential for rapid price appreciation: Memecoins can experience significant price increases in a short period. 

Community-driven: Memecoins often have strong communities that support and promote the token. 

Fun and engaging: Memecoins can be a fun and enjoyable way to participate in the cryptocurrency market.

Q: What are the risks of investing in memecoins?

A: High volatility: Memecoin prices can fluctuate rapidly, leading to significant losses.

Lack of fundamental value: Memecoins often lack underlying assets or real-world utility. 

Regulatory uncertainty: The regulatory landscape for memecoins can be uncertain, potentially affecting their future.
